何のスクロールバーデルファイ埋め込まれたWebブラウザーノーボーダーを聞かせていません

ExpandedBlockStart.gif コード
{  WB_Set3DBorderStyle  } 手順 WB_Set3DBorderStyle(送信者:TWebBrowser; bValue:ブール値); VaRの  ドキュメント:IHTMLDocument2。  要素:IHTMLElement。  StrBorderStyle:  文字列; 開始// 边框去掉てみ    文書を:=  TWebBrowser(送信者).Document  として IHTMLDocument2。場合 (文書)を割り当て  、その後始まる      要素を:=  Document.Body。場合 要素  <> nilが、その後始まるケースを BValue 







  

  


    

    


      
   
      

        

          偽:StrBorderStyle:
= ' なし' ;           真:StrBorderStyle:= '' ; エンド;         Element.Style.BorderStyle:=  StrBorderStyle。エンド; エンド;    // 去掉滚动条      Sender.OleObject.Document.Body.Scroll:= ' なし'ありません除く// .. 終了エンド;  
 
        


      

    

 
  

    

  

 

この関数は唯一のTWebBrowserは、ページファイルを読み込む終了したら、それを呼び出します。

そして、htmlファイルの先頭には、置き換える
<DOCTYPE HTML PUBLICを! " - // W3C // DTD HTML 4.01移行// EN">

ます。https://www.cnblogs.com/rogee/archive/2010/09/20/1832037.htmlで再現

おすすめ

転載: blog.csdn.net/weixin_34289454/article/details/94681085